The Pole Returns Very Different

Now, it is undeniable that the Polo has returned and has consolidated itself back as a staple of the men's wardrobe. Although, as we mentioned earlier, it was a very popular garment among men in the 90s, the classic Polo is many years older.

When we talk about its beginnings, we observe the mega classic Polo that was invented by René Lacoste, who, long before becoming what it is today with its recognized crocodile, was previously known as one of the most outstanding athletes.

By that time, the connotation of this garment was very different from what we know today. This type of sports fashion dictated an undeniable status symbol, but it also emphasized classic elegance.

Thus, Polo grew and expanded to become part of other sports so that, later on, it would fulfill another role among men, becoming a staple for weekend outings, and today, a staple that serves for any occasion.

On the other hand, and doing their thing, are the rugby polos, which are becoming increasingly popular, having been timidly approaching our wardrobes as a kind of micro trend for several seasons now.

Trends are not just for the stars, although it seems that this will be a definitive season for these fabulous garments. Once again, fashion clings to concepts from nostalgia to recover those attractive and eye-catching polos, with colorful striped patterns that were trendy over 10 years ago and today walk the runway at Prada, Neil Barrett, MSGM, or Dolce & Gabbana as if they were the most modern thing on the planet. Shia LaBeouf and David Beckham are the most frequent and fierce models of these spectacular polos.
